    Abstract

    The following article, "Quality Improvement Practices and Trends in Denmark," is
    the first in a series of papers arranged for and co-authored by Dr. Rick L. Edgeman. Rick is a member of QE's Editorial Board and is on sabbatical from Colorado State University. During the year, Rick and his family will be visiting various countries in Europe and he will be reporting to us with respect to each
    country in which they stay for any period of time. His reports will take the form of
    co-authored paperswith the other authors including distinguished faculty from the universities with which he works as a visiting professor, as well as key individuals from various industries.
    In addition to the above activities, Rick will be working with the European Foundation for Quality Management on their "European Master's Programme in
    Total Quality Management." That program involves a consortium of European universities. Rick has begun the process of developing a comparable consortium
    of American universities for the same purpose-- an activity which is cosponsored by the Education Division of the American Society for Quality (ASQ).
